| package org.apache.tapestry5.internal.plastic.asm; |
| |
| final class RecordComponentWriter extends RecordComponentVisitor { |
| /** Where the constants used in this RecordComponentWriter must be stored. */ |
| private final SymbolTable symbolTable; |
| |
| // Note: fields are ordered as in the record_component_info structure, and those related to |
| // attributes are ordered as in Section 4.7 of the JVMS. |
| |
| /** The name_index field of the Record attribute. */ |
| private final int nameIndex; |
| |
| /** The descriptor_index field of the the Record attribute. */ |
| private final int descriptorIndex; |
| |
| /** |
| * The signature_index field of the Signature attribute of this record component, or 0 if there is |
| * no Signature attribute. |
| */ |
| private int signatureIndex; |
| |
| /** |
| * The last runtime visible annotation of this record component. The previous ones can be accessed |
| * with the {@link AnnotationWriter#previousAnnotation} field. May be {@literal null}. |
| */ |
| private AnnotationWriter lastRuntimeVisibleAnnotation; |
| |
| /** |
| * The last runtime invisible annotation of this record component. The previous ones can be |
| * accessed with the {@link AnnotationWriter#previousAnnotation} field. May be {@literal null}. |
| */ |
| private AnnotationWriter lastRuntimeInvisibleAnnotation; |
| |
| /** |
| * The last runtime visible type annotation of this record component. The previous ones can be |
| * accessed with the {@link AnnotationWriter#previousAnnotation} field. May be {@literal null}. |
| */ |
| private AnnotationWriter lastRuntimeVisibleTypeAnnotation; |
| |
| /** |
| * The last runtime invisible type annotation of this record component. The previous ones can be |
| * accessed with the {@link AnnotationWriter#previousAnnotation} field. May be {@literal null}. |
| */ |
| private AnnotationWriter lastRuntimeInvisibleTypeAnnotation; |
| |
| /** |
| * The first non standard attribute of this record component. The next ones can be accessed with |
| * the {@link Attribute#nextAttribute} field. May be {@literal null}. |
| * |
| * <p><b>WARNING</b>: this list stores the attributes in the <i>reverse</i> order of their visit. |
| * firstAttribute is actually the last attribute visited in {@link #visitAttribute(Attribute)}. |
| * The {@link #putRecordComponentInfo(ByteVector)} method writes the attributes in the order |
| * defined by this list, i.e. in the reverse order specified by the user. |
| */ |
| private Attribute firstAttribute; |
| |
| /** |
| * Constructs a new {@link RecordComponentWriter}. |
| * |
| * @param symbolTable where the constants used in this RecordComponentWriter must be stored. |
| * @param name the record component name. |
| * @param descriptor the record component descriptor (see {@link Type}). |
| * @param signature the record component signature. May be {@literal null}. |
| */ |
| RecordComponentWriter( |
| final SymbolTable symbolTable, |
| final String name, |
| final String descriptor, |
| final String signature) { |
| super(/* latest api = */ Opcodes.ASM8); |
| this.symbolTable = symbolTable; |
| this.nameIndex = symbolTable.addConstantUtf8(name); |
| this.descriptorIndex = symbolTable.addConstantUtf8(descriptor); |
| if (signature != null) { |
| this.signatureIndex = symbolTable.addConstantUtf8(signature); |
| } |
| } |
| |
| // ----------------------------------------------------------------------------------------------- |
| // Implementation of the FieldVisitor abstract class |
| // ----------------------------------------------------------------------------------------------- |
| |
| @Override |
| public AnnotationVisitor visitAnnotation(final String descriptor, final boolean visible) { |
| if (visible) { |
| return lastRuntimeVisibleAnnotation = |
| AnnotationWriter.create(symbolTable, descriptor, lastRuntimeVisibleAnnotation); |
| } else { |
| return lastRuntimeInvisibleAnnotation = |
| AnnotationWriter.create(symbolTable, descriptor, lastRuntimeInvisibleAnnotation); |
| } |
| } |
| |
| @Override |
| public AnnotationVisitor visitTypeAnnotation( |
| final int typeRef, final TypePath typePath, final String descriptor, final boolean visible) { |
| if (visible) { |
| return lastRuntimeVisibleTypeAnnotation = |
| AnnotationWriter.create( |
| symbolTable, typeRef, typePath, descriptor, lastRuntimeVisibleTypeAnnotation); |
| } else { |
| return lastRuntimeInvisibleTypeAnnotation = |
| AnnotationWriter.create( |
| symbolTable, typeRef, typePath, descriptor, lastRuntimeInvisibleTypeAnnotation); |
| } |
| } |
| |
| @Override |
| public void visitAttribute(final Attribute attribute) { |
| // Store the attributes in the <i>reverse</i> order of their visit by this method. |
| attribute.nextAttribute = firstAttribute; |
| firstAttribute = attribute; |
| } |
| |
| @Override |
| public void visitEnd() { |
| // Nothing to do. |
| } |
| |
| // ----------------------------------------------------------------------------------------------- |
| // Utility methods |
| // ----------------------------------------------------------------------------------------------- |
| |
| /** |
| * Returns the size of the record component JVMS structure generated by this |
| * RecordComponentWriter. Also adds the names of the attributes of this record component in the |
| * constant pool. |
| * |
| * @return the size in bytes of the record_component_info of the Record attribute. |
| */ |
| int computeRecordComponentInfoSize() { |
| // name_index, descriptor_index and attributes_count fields use 6 bytes. |
| int size = 6; |
| size += Attribute.computeAttributesSize(symbolTable, 0, signatureIndex); |
| size += |
| AnnotationWriter.computeAnnotationsSize( |
| lastRuntimeVisibleAnnotation, |
| lastRuntimeInvisibleAnnotation, |
| lastRuntimeVisibleTypeAnnotation, |
| lastRuntimeInvisibleTypeAnnotation); |
| if (firstAttribute != null) { |
| size += firstAttribute.computeAttributesSize(symbolTable); |
| } |
| return size; |
| } |
| |
| /** |
| * Puts the content of the record component generated by this RecordComponentWriter into the given |
| * ByteVector. |
| * |
| * @param output where the record_component_info structure must be put. |
| */ |
| void putRecordComponentInfo(final ByteVector output) { |
| output.putShort(nameIndex).putShort(descriptorIndex); |
| // Compute and put the attributes_count field. |
| // For ease of reference, we use here the same attribute order as in Section 4.7 of the JVMS. |
| int attributesCount = 0; |
| if (signatureIndex != 0) { |
| ++attributesCount; |
| } |
| if (lastRuntimeVisibleAnnotation != null) { |
| ++attributesCount; |
| } |
| if (lastRuntimeInvisibleAnnotation != null) { |
| ++attributesCount; |
| } |
| if (lastRuntimeVisibleTypeAnnotation != null) { |
| ++attributesCount; |
| } |
| if (lastRuntimeInvisibleTypeAnnotation != null) { |
| ++attributesCount; |
| } |
| if (firstAttribute != null) { |
| attributesCount += firstAttribute.getAttributeCount(); |
| } |
| output.putShort(attributesCount); |
| Attribute.putAttributes(symbolTable, 0, signatureIndex, output); |
| AnnotationWriter.putAnnotations( |
| symbolTable, |
| lastRuntimeVisibleAnnotation, |
| lastRuntimeInvisibleAnnotation, |
| lastRuntimeVisibleTypeAnnotation, |
| lastRuntimeInvisibleTypeAnnotation, |
| output); |
| if (firstAttribute != null) { |
| firstAttribute.putAttributes(symbolTable, output); |
| } |
| } |
| |
| /** |
| * Collects the attributes of this record component into the given set of attribute prototypes. |
| * |
| * @param attributePrototypes a set of attribute prototypes. |
| */ |
| final void collectAttributePrototypes(final Attribute.Set attributePrototypes) { |
| attributePrototypes.addAttributes(firstAttribute); |
| } |
| } |
